A Comparative Study Of The Writing Of Power In Kafka's And Yu Hua's Novels

As one of the most famous writer in the modernist literature of the 20 th century,Franz Kafka's novels not only made great contributions to the development of western literature,but also had a profound influence on Chinese contemporary novelists in the later 20 th century.However Yu Hua is one of the writer who accepts Kafka's influence mostly.His works reveal the inheritance and innovation of Kafka's spirit.The Castle and The Seventh Day are the important works of Kafka and Yu Hua respectively,both of them with a strong era characteristic and reveal the current social situation.The character of these novels are the writing of power,which can reveal the secret operation of power.This thesis will explores the writing of power in the two works firstly.Based on Foucault's power theory,analyzing the power relations and power network from the aspects of sex,power discourse and cultural critique,exploring the connection of power in the western and Chinese novelist.It is not coincidentally that the novels have similar writing style on the writing of power,which have inseparable relationship to the influence of the writer's inner and outer environment.The following is the exploration of the reasons for the writing of power in Kafka's and Yu Hua's novels.One is the writer's emotional experience,which affects their later creation.The other is the influence from the author's external environment,which forms a unique cognitive view of the world.The last is the influence of the well-known people's thoughts.Kafka's acceptance mainly comes from philosophical thought,while Yu Hua's creation is influenced by Kafka,which makes him close to Kafka both on style and theme of the work.Yu hua not only in the process of accepting the influence of Kafka's creation thought,but also constantly explore its own path,and his innovation mainly displays in three aspects: the handling of material,the interpretation of power and the art of narrative.In the end,this thesis will discusses the value and significance of Kafka's and Yu Hua's writing of power from the aspect of the aesthetic.Kafka expresses the philosophical thought that from real life to metaphysics,while Yu Hua choose the way from real life to metaphysics and then back to life.In spite of the different ways of using,the ultimate reality is to show concern for human survival.
